Dozens of Christians killed in Democratic Republic of Congo – Open Doors

A burial following one of the devastating attacks on Christians in recent weeks. (Photo: Open Doors) At least 80 Christians have been killed in a wave of attacks in the Democratic Republic Congo, according to Open Doors.  The attacks happened across villages in North Kivu between 4 and 8 June.
